The bound quarterly stock-count ledger for the Renwick Depot was scheduled for collection yesterday at 14:00 but the courier from Larkspan Transit did not arrive. The ledger remains sealed in the records cage, countersigned by both tally clerks, and must reach the Ostwell archive before the audit window closes Thursday. A replacement run has been booked for tomorrow morning. Please confirm the seal number on release. The following hand-over instruction applies to the rescheduled courier and must be followed exactly.

handover note for yagef-bagep: the drudor pelius courier leaves the kasdor zorvan norir ledger at gate 8016 under passcode 755406

**Mgmt Meeting Minutes — Retiring the Brightline Range**

Quick recap for sales leads at Fenholt Supplies: we agreed to retire the Brightline fixture range by year-end. Remaining stock moves to clearance pricing next month, and accounts on standing orders get migrated to the Lumetta range. Trade-in incentives were approved in principle. The confidential note on next steps sits just below.

board note of bajof-bajeg: The pricing group signed off on a budget of $13.4 million for Project Sildor. The renewal with Lamixek Holdings closes at $48.9 million a year, 49 percent above the last contract.

**First-day checklist — key cabinet (pool cars)**

New starter must be shown the pool car key cabinet in the Hollowbeck depot before end of day one. Confirm: cabinet location (ground floor, beside the loading bay door), sign-out sheet procedure, key return cut-off at 18:00, and fuel card rules. Facilities desk verifies the starter's induction record first. Issue nothing until that's done. Cabinet opens with the code below.

door code, yagap-bahof: bdg-O-05